Key job responsibilities
- Data analysis with tools like Excel (Pivot)(Macro/Powerbi - Added Advantage).
- Data extraction and analysis through SQL and scheduling quality KPI jobs
- Work a flexible schedule/shift/work area including weekends nights and/or holidays.
- Can lift stand/walk during shifts lasting up to 11 hours and be able to frequently push pull squat bend and reach.
- Work 50 hours/week and overtime as required.
- Manage and skill development of frontline workers and process associates to drive quality initiatives
- Ensuring inventory food safety and danger goods compliance

A day in the life
Daily/ weekly/ monthly Research activities: Data mining and understand the reasons for Quality Defects
Prepare and publish daily/ weekly/ monthly reports on inventory quality (IRDR/ Large adjustments/ Unmatched X Top20 reports/ HRV adjustments etc)
Bin Management and control (creation/addition/deletion/bin locks)
Conduct daily training and also will be responsible to conduct daily skill huddles
Driving Quality trainings and initiatives to frontline associates
Stand-in for Process Associate and the Area Manager
